What is Rapid Prototyping?

Rapid prototyping refers to a collection of techniques used to quickly fabricate a scale model or prototype of a physical part or assembly using 3D computer-aided design (CAD) data. The goal is to create a tangible prototype that allows for physical testing and evaluation, helping designers identify flaws or improvements in the design before committing to mass production.

Technologies used for rapid prototyping include 3D printing, CNC machining, injection molding, and vacuum casting. These methods allow designers and manufacturers to experiment with different materials, sizes, and finishes at a speed and cost that were previously unattainable with traditional methods.

The Importance of Superior Accuracy in Prototyping

While speed is important, accuracy
is the defining factor in determining the success of a prototype. A prototype must closely mirror the final product in order to serve its purpose — whether it’s for functional testing, material evaluation, or assessing ergonomics. Superior accuracy in rapid prototyping enables companies to:

  • Validate designs quickly: By creating highly accurate prototypes, designers can identify potential issues early in the process, reducing the risk of costly revisions later on.
  • Refine product functionality: An accurate prototype can be used to test how a product will perform in real-world conditions, ensuring that all components work as intended.
  • Enhance communication: With highly detailed prototypes, designers can clearly communicate their ideas with stakeholders, clients, and investors, enabling faster decision-making.
  • Reduce production costs: Early detection of design flaws can help avoid costly mistakes during the manufacturing phase.

2. CNC Machining for Precision Parts

For clients needing highly durable and functional prototypes, Luxciry uses CNC (Computer Numerical Control) machining, a subtractive manufacturing process that is known for its precision and accuracy. CNC machining involves cutting away material from a solid block to create the desired part. This method is ideal for prototypes that require tight tolerances and a high degree of strength, such as mechanical components in the automotive or aerospace industries.

By combining CNC machining with advanced CAD modeling, Luxciry can produce prototypes that not only match the design specifications but also offer a realistic representation of how the final part will behave under stress or wear.

4. Vacuum Casting for Complex Details

Another area where Luxciry excels is in vacuum casting, a technique that is ideal for creating prototypes with intricate designs and complex details. Vacuum casting is used when the master model needs to be replicated with high accuracy, and the resulting prototype must mirror the final product in terms of both aesthetics and function.

This process is particularly useful for creating small batch prototypes or low-volume production parts, allowing businesses to test their designs before committing to more expensive manufacturing methods like injection molding. By using high-quality silicone molds and a range of casting resins, Luxciry ensures that every detail of the prototype is accurately reproduced.
